Honey, lemon juice and ginger combine for a delightful dressing for fruit. A refreshing salad or dessert for picnics, pot lucks, barbecues and brunches. Dress up your fruit salad with a sprinkling of chopped almonds for a sweet and crunchy treat. Serve chilled. *Do not give honey to children under the age of one.

The ingredients needed to make 🎶Gingered Honey Fruit Salad 🎵:
  1. Prepare 2 Small ataulfo mangos ,peeled and cut into chunks
  2. Take 1 cup Fresh blueberries
  3. Get 3 Baby bananas, peeled and sliced
  4. Make ready 1 cup Strawberries
  5. Prepare 1 cup seedless green grapes
  6. Prepare 1 cup nectarines,sliced
  7. Get 1 cup kiwifruit,peeled and sliced
  8. Take Ginger Honey Sauce:
  9. Make ready 1/3 cup 100% orange juice
  10. Get 2 tbsp lemon juice
  11. Get 1 tbsp honey
  12. Get 1/8 tsp ground nutmeg
  13. Make ready 1/8 tsp ground ginger

Here is how you cook that. Note: Mango, pineapple, and kiwi can be cut the night before serving. Do not cut peaches and strawberries until right before serving. Leftover fruit is wonderful served on top of sliced of pound cake.

Instructions to make 🎶Gingered Honey Fruit Salad 🎵:
  1. In a large bowl, combine fruit.
  2. In a small bowl, mix all honey ginger sauce ingredients until well blended.
  3. Pour honey ginger sauce over fruit and toss together.
  4. Refrigerate for at least 20 minutes and serve chilled.
